Details
A vulnerability was found in Samsung Devices (version unknown). It has been classified as problematic. This affects an unknown function of the component Android Application Component. The manipulation with an unknown input leads to a improper export of android application components vulnerability. CWE is classifying the issue as CWE-926. The Android application exports a component for use by other applications, but does not properly restrict which applications can launch the component or access the data it contains. This is going to have an impact on confidentiality. The summary by CVE is:
Improper export of android application components in ImsSettings prior to SMR Jun-2026 Release 1 allows local attackers to trigger logging function.
It is possible to read the advisory at security.samsungmobile.com. This vulnerability is uniquely identified as CVE-2026-21027 since 12/11/2025. The exploitability is told to be easy. Attacking locally is a requirement. The technical details are unknown and an exploit is not publicly available.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
